What companies run services between Weybridge, England and East Dulwich, England?

You can take a train from Weybridge to Peckham Rye via Clapham Junction in around 52 min.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Library to Derwent Grove via Cromwell Road Bus Station and Putney Heath / Green Man in around 2h 27m.
